Significance of the uterine glycogenproducing glands

Describe the significance of the uterine glycogenproducing glands? How long after ovulation should fecundation happen to be effective?

The uterine glands form glycogen which can be degraded in glucose to nourish the embryo before the complete development of placenta. When fecundation doesn’t happens about 24 hours then ovulation the released ovum generallydies.
